Two cars start towards each other, from two places A and B which are at a distance of 160 km. They start at the same time 08 ∶ 10 AM. If the speeds of the cars are 50 km per hour and 30 km per hour respectively, they will meet each other at Correct Answer 10 ∶ 10 AM
Given:
The distance between A and B = 160 km
Speed of car1 = 50 km per hour
Speed of car2 = 30 km per hour
Concept used:
If two trains are moving in opposite directions at u m/s and v m/s, then relative speed is = (u + v) m/s
Formula used:
Time = Distance/Speed
Calculation:
Relative speed = (speed of car1 + speed of car2)
⇒ Relative speed = (50 + 30) = 80 km/hr
⇒ Time = Distance/Time
⇒ Time = 160/80 = 2 hours
They start at the same time 08 ∶ 10 AM
⇒ Time = 08 ∶ 10 AM + 2 = 10 : 10 AM
∴ They will meet each other at 10 : 10 AM
